Night shift staff should note that the guest Wi-Fi desk at the Dunmorrow Point reception remains staffed only until 22:00. After that hour, any visitor requiring network access must be signed in manually in the overnight ledger, and credentials issued from the sealed envelopes in the reception drawer. The drawer and the desk terminal are both secured; to unlock them, use the access code below.

turnstile pass: bdg-YPPQB-52010

FAQ: How do I regain access to the Pedalgrid rebalancer admin console?

If the rebalancing scheduler for the Larkmoor bike-share fleet locks you out, the truck-routing jobs keep running from the last cached plan, so there's no immediate service impact. Future maintainers should use the break-glass account rather than resetting the main credentials, since a reset clears station weighting history. The break-glass account unlocks only with the recovery passphrase shown below.

unlock words, tawif-tahop: oliys-ulawyn-tamdor-lamys-casox-jormir-fraius-kasath-ulador-ulamir-holir-sorys-holeth

During the upcoming site audit by Hartwell Estates, the landlord of Brindle Quay, night-shift staff should expect auditors accompanied by a facilities escort between 23:00 and 03:00. All visitors must wear orange audit lanyards and remain with their escort at all times; do not admit anyone claiming audit access without one. Normal visitor sign-in rules still apply at the night desk. If auditors need access to the plant room corridor, the escort will use the standard door code, which is:

door code, yagap-bahof: bdg-O-05

MEMO to the Board — Kestwin Foods
From: P. Arlow, CFO

Short version: we're trimming the marketing budget by a fifth next year. The Glimmerbrand campaign underdelivered, and we'd rather bank the savings while freight costs stay ugly. Regional sponsorships survive; broadcast spend doesn't. How this ties into wider plans is covered in the confidential note below.

management briefing: The renewal with Quenathox Group closes at $10 million a year, 20 percent below the last contract. Project Ulawyn slips by two quarters because of the supplier delay.